电工技术基础_电工基础知识_电工之家-电工学习网

欢迎来到电工学习网!

单片机开发板怎么运行

2023-10-15 07:07分类:电工基础知识 阅读:

 

单片机开发板是一种集成了单片机芯片和各种外设接口的开发工具,用于开发和调试嵌入式系统。它的运行涉及到多个方面,包括硬件和软件两个层面。下面将从这两个方面对单片机开发板的运行进行阐述。

从硬件方面来看,单片机开发板的运行离不开电源供应和外设接口的支持。单片机开发板通常需要通过外部电源或USB接口提供电源。在电源供应的基础上,开发板上的各种外设接口起到了连接外部设备和单片机芯片的作用。例如,常见的GPIO口可以用来连接LED灯、按键等外部设备,而UART接口可以用来与其他设备进行串口通信。这些外设接口的连接和配置,直接影响着单片机开发板的运行。

从软件方面来看,单片机开发板的运行需要借助开发环境和编程语言。常见的开发环境包括Keil、IAR等,它们提供了一套完整的开发工具链,包括编译器、调试器等。开发人员可以使用这些工具进行代码编写、编译和调试。而编程语言方面,C语言是最常用的单片机编程语言,它具有简洁、高效的特点,适合嵌入式系统的开发。开发人员可以利用C语言编写程序,通过开发环境将程序烧录到单片机芯片中,从而实现单片机开发板的运行。

单片机开发板的运行还需要考虑时钟和中断的支持。时钟是单片机系统的基础,它提供了时序和频率参考。开发人员需要配置时钟源,并根据需要设置时钟频率。中断是单片机系统中常用的一种机制,它可以在特定的条件下中断正常的程序执行,执行中断服务程序。通过中断,可以实现对外部事件的响应和处理,提高系统的实时性和效率。

一下,单片机开发板的运行涉及到硬件和软件两个方面。在硬件方面,电源供应和外设接口的支持是基础;在软件方面,开发环境和编程语言是关键。时钟和中断的配置也是运行的重要因素。只有充分理解和掌握这些方面,才能实现单片机开发板的正常运行。

上一篇:单片机开发板怎么用的

下一篇:单片机开发板怎么使用

相关推荐

电工推荐

    电工技术基础_电工基础知识_电工之家-电工学习网
返回顶部